Barclaycard Business carbon-offset corporate charge card
Barclaycard Business has announced the launch of a carbon-offset corporate charge card that will enable customers to offset carbon emissions associated with air travel.The card is the first commercial card in the world that facilitates the offset of a company’s air travel. By tracking a company’s spend in this area, Barclaycard Business Sustain enables corporate customers to develop a clearer picture of the carbon footprint caused by their air travel, and Barclaycard Business are then able to work with their customers to help offset their carbon emissions. The card also encourages a company’s employees to think about - and do something about - the impact their business travel has on the environment.

Barclaycard Business manages the whole carbon offset process on behalf of its corporate customers by providing them with commission-free access to the Certified Emission Reduction Market via Barclays Capital’s Emissions Trading Desk – the largest in Europe. Barclays Capital purchases Certified Emissions Reductions (CERs) on behalf of the customer at zero commission - thus allowing the maximum amount of carbon to be offset - and then arranges for the CERs to be cancelled, effectively ensuring that the certificates are non-tradable in the future. As a result, the customer receives cancelled CER certificates, and the knowledge that the environmental impact of their business travel has been offset.
